Abstract
A system (100), for measurement of temperatures and detection of faults of parallel transformers in a DDC enclosure (101), that comprises a first transformer (102) and a second transformer (104) arranged in a parallel configuration that deliver power to components of a building management system (BMS). The system (100) also comprises a direct digital control (DDC) circuit that controls power delivered through the first and the second transformers (102, 104) to the components of the building management system (BMS). The system (100) further comprises a first temperature sensor (108), operationally connected to the DDC circuit, which measures the temperature of the first transformer (102). Furthermore, the system (100) comprises a second temperature sensor (110), operationally connected to the DDC circuit, which measures the temperature of the second transformer (104). The DDC circuit determines a difference between the first temperature and the second temperature to predict a fault in the first transformer (102) or the second transformer (104).
